Patient Services / Front Office
- Greet and check in patients in a warm, professional manner
- Explain insurance benefits, coverage, and out-of-pocket costs clearly and compassionately
- Collect and process patient payments accurately
- Answer phones, manage messages, and respond to patient communications
- Enter and maintain accurate patient and insurance information in the EHR
- Maintain an organized, clean, and welcoming front desk and waiting area
- Support scheduling, administrative tasks, and clinic flow
- Complete daily cash reconciliation and bank deposits
Clinical Responsibilities
- Obtain and document vital signs for all patients
- Perform phlebotomy and injections independently
- Absorb and assist providers with clinical procedures as needed
- Operate EKG and point-of-care testing equipment per protocol
- Prepare lab requisitions and patient plans in advance
- Support efficient patient flow, rooming patients within 10–15 minutes
- Clean, stock, and inventory exam rooms daily
- Complete all required clinical and operational logs
- Handle and process patient specimens according to lab protocols
- Perform quality control documentation and instrument maintenance
- Identify and report any issues affecting test accuracy
Qualifications
- 6 months of experience as a back-office medical assistant or completion of an externship in lieu of certification (required)
- High school diploma or GED required
- Previous experience in a medical office, clinic, or healthcare setting preferred
- Strong patient service, communication, and interpersonal skills
- Comfortable discussing insurance, billing, and payment options with patients
- Proficient with electronic health records and Microsoft Office
- Highly organized, detail-oriented, and able to multitask in a fast-paced clinic
